How to become a Speech Recognition Engineer

How do i become a Speech Recognition Engineer?

To become a Speech Recognition Engineer, start by earning a degree in computer science, engineering, or a related field. Develop strong programming skills and gain knowledge in speech processing, machine learning, and natural language processing. Build hands-on experience through projects, internships, or research. Advanced degrees or contributions to open-source projects can further enhance your prospects. Networking and staying updated with the latest advancements are also key to breaking into the industry.

Earn a relevant degree

Obtain a bachelor's degree in computer science, electrical engineering, linguistics, or a related field.

Gain programming skills

Develop strong programming skills in languages such as Python, C++, or Java, which are commonly used in speech recognition projects.

Study speech processing and machine learning

Take specialized courses or self-study topics like digital signal processing, natural language processing, and machine learning.

Build hands-on experience

Work on projects or internships involving speech recognition, audio processing, or related AI technologies.

Pursue advanced education (optional)

Consider earning a master's or PhD in a relevant field to deepen your expertise and improve job prospects.

Contribute to open-source or research

Participate in open-source speech recognition projects or publish research to build your portfolio.

Apply for jobs

Look for entry-level positions or research roles in companies or academic labs focused on speech recognition.

Typical requirements of a Speech Recognition Engineer

Bachelor’s or higher degree

A degree in computer science, electrical engineering, linguistics, or a related field is typically required.

Programming proficiency

Strong skills in programming languages such as Python, C++, or Java.

Knowledge of speech processing

Understanding of digital signal processing, speech recognition algorithms, and natural language processing.

Experience with machine learning frameworks

Familiarity with tools like TensorFlow, PyTorch, or Kaldi.

Analytical and problem-solving skills

Ability to analyze complex problems and develop innovative solutions.

Alternative ways to become a Speech Recognition Engineer

Self-taught route

Learn speech recognition and machine learning through online courses, tutorials, and personal projects.

Bootcamps and certifications

Attend specialized bootcamps or earn certifications in AI, machine learning, or speech processing.

Transition from related fields

Move into speech recognition from adjacent roles such as software engineering, data science, or linguistics.

Open-source contributions

Gain recognition and experience by contributing to open-source speech recognition projects.

Industry research positions

Start in a research assistant or junior role in an academic or corporate lab and specialize in speech recognition.

How to break into the industry as a Speech Recognition Engineer

Build a strong portfolio

Showcase your skills with projects, code samples, or research related to speech recognition.

Network with professionals

Connect with industry experts through conferences, meetups, or online forums.

Apply for internships

Gain practical experience and industry contacts through internships in relevant companies or labs.

Stay updated with latest research

Read academic papers and follow advancements in speech recognition technology.

Participate in competitions

Join machine learning or speech recognition competitions to demonstrate your abilities.

Tailor your resume and cover letter

Highlight relevant skills, projects, and experience when applying for jobs.

Seek mentorship

Find mentors in the field who can provide guidance and career advice.

Ready to start?Try Canyon for free today.